Filippo Rossi invites readers on an enlightening journey that explores the divine essence residing within the material world. Through a rich tapestry of thought and reflection, he encourages believers to reconsider their relationship with the physical and spiritual realms, revealing a profound dignity that exists in every object around them.
Throughout the narrative, Rossi eloquently articulates the interplay between faith and the tangible, prompting readers to see God’s presence imbued in the everyday. This exploration challenges traditional perceptions and fosters a deeper appreciation for the beauty and significance of the material existence.
As he weaves together philosophy and spirituality, Rossi’s works serve as a compelling reminder of the sacredness found in the mundane. Through his profound insights, readers are invited to embark on a transformative journey that elevates their understanding of both faith and the world they inhabit.
